Transaction abf110d2fe696784106fdd5a52cea24fe65e8c5c8111df223c4855fe6fcf3e05

2 Input
2 Outputs
  • abf110d2fe696784106fdd5a52cea24fe65e8c5c8111df223c4855fe6fcf3e05:0
  • value  1659534
    address  38HXVwsLrqrf4C6WpJH6qDtQsPPgQV5PRn
  • abf110d2fe696784106fdd5a52cea24fe65e8c5c8111df223c4855fe6fcf3e05:1
  • value  1766806
    address  34ZHSZSiFCWpVvKKuXJ4LLccK5ov15Azk3